Born in 1983 into a family of teachers and traditional artists, this Balinese jeweler carries forward a cultural heritage rooted in detail and sincerity. His grandfather, a dancer and painter, instilled in him an eye for design and the importance of creating with heart. Though he first worked aboard cruise ships to support his family, the discipline and empathy he developed during those years now enrich his craft. Together with his wife, he creates jewelry inspired by traditional Balinese architecture and weaving patterns, blending them with modern, elegant forms. In his workshop, silver, copper, and gemstones are shaped into distinctive designs that reflect Bali’s artistic spirit. Recognized for his talent, he was chosen to represent Bali in the 2017 Australia Short Course Awards and received the International Business Readiness Award for jewelry design. For him, each piece is both heritage and innovation—an offering of beauty shaped by perseverance.
